Before we begin with any cosmetic work, we will examine and clean the patient's teeth. It does not matter how straight or white your teeth are if they are infected. It is critical that your teeth are healthy prior to any procedure we perform. If the teeth are not healthy, then you will be at risk of getting a toothache, having your gums swell, having the gums bleed and even losing your teeth. This is entirely avoidable by practicing good oral hygiene and having your teeth cleaned on a regular basis.

Teeth Whitening

Once your teeth are healthy and clean, we can begin your smile makeover. Typically, the first thing we suggest doing is whitening your teeth. A teeth whitening procedure is fast, easy and affordable. Not only is the impact dramatic, some people feel like they do not need any other treatments immediately after a teeth whitening procedure. If you decide for something like a dental veneer, crown or implant, the material we use to create them will be both stain and bleach resistant. While this is excellent in the long-term, it means that your new tooth would be made to match the old ones. If they are yellow, your veneer would be yellow, if they are white, your veneer would be white. The exception to this is if you are having veneers placed on all of the teeth that you can see, instead of using it to correct one crooked tooth. In that case, your veneers would cover all of your stained and yellow teeth so how white they were or were not, it would not make a difference.

Cosmetic Dentistry Procedures

Next, we will determine what issues you have that you also wish to correct, such as closing gaps in between your teeth, covering severely dark stains, straightening teeth, changing their shape and size, or even making adjustments to your gums.
